Bless Your Neighbors

Dave Ferguson shared some good ideas on the Verge Blog this week. It struck me as an easy way to think about the relationship building process. He gave 5 key activities:

    B- Begin with prayer. We want you to ask, ‘God how do you want me to bless the people in the places you’ve sent me to?’
    L- Listen. Don’t talk, but listen to people, their struggles, their pains, in the places God sent you.
    E- Eat. You can’t just check this off. It’s not quick. You have to have a meal with people or a cup of coffee. It builds relationships.
    S- Serve. If you listen with people and you eat with people they will tell you how to love them and you’ll know how to serve them.
    S- Story. When the time is right, now we talk and we share the story of how Jesus changed our life.
